  • Condor Tool & Knife Terrachete.
    Designed by Joe Flowers.
    Specifications:
    Blade Length: 14.60"
    Handle Length: 6.12"
    Overall Length: 20.72"
    Blade Material: 1075 High Carbon Steel
    Blade Thickness: 0.120"
    Blade Grind: Convex
    Handle Material: Polypropylene
    Sheath Material: Thermoplastic
    Weight: 25.4 oz.
    Made in El Salvador
